Sony's additional $13 million investment in its partnership with Startale, following the first anniversary of Soneium's mainnet launch, signals a strategic commitment to blockchain infrastructure development. This move suggests Sony is positioning itself for long-term involvement in the Web3 ecosystem, leveraging Soneium's established network activity to build foundational technology rather than pursuing speculative applications.
The investment reflects growing corporate confidence in blockchain's infrastructure potential, particularly from established technology giants diversifying into decentralized systems. While the amount represents a modest allocation for Sony, its timing after a year of mainnet operation indicates validation of Soneium's technical viability and real-world utility. This development may encourage similar strategic investments from other traditional technology firms exploring blockchain integration.
